Biotin and Diagnostic Test Interference

One of the most significant and potentially dangerous downsides of biotin supplementation is its ability to interfere with laboratory tests. Many medical assays, particularly those using biotin-streptavidin technology, are affected by high levels of biotin in the blood. The U.S. Food and Drug Administration (FDA) has issued warnings regarding this risk, which can lead to misleading or inaccurate results for various health conditions.

Inaccurate Medical Test Results

The interference caused by biotin can lead to misdiagnosis and, in severe cases, inappropriate or delayed treatment. The tests most commonly affected include:

  • Thyroid function tests: Biotin can cause falsely low thyroid-stimulating hormone (TSH) levels and falsely high T3 and T4 levels, potentially leading to a misdiagnosis of hyperthyroidism.
  • Troponin tests: Used to diagnose heart attacks, troponin tests can produce falsely low results in patients with high biotin levels, delaying a critical diagnosis.
  • Hormone tests: Assays for hormones such as parathyroid hormone and reproductive hormones can also be skewed by biotin.

It is essential to inform your healthcare provider about any biotin supplements you are taking before undergoing bloodwork. Doctors may advise you to stop taking biotin for several days before testing to ensure accurate results.

Common Side Effects of Biotin Overdose

While biotin is water-soluble and any excess is typically excreted in the urine, high-dose supplements can still trigger undesirable side effects. These symptoms usually resolve when the dosage is reduced or supplementation is stopped.

Skin and Digestive Issues

Some of the most frequently reported side effects include skin and gastrointestinal problems:

  • Acne: Biotin can increase sebum (oil) production, leading to clogged pores and breakouts, particularly on the face, chin, and jawline.
  • Digestive discomfort: Nausea, stomach cramps, and diarrhea can occur, especially when taking high doses without food.
  • Rashes: In some cases, skin rashes may appear as an allergic reaction.

Other Adverse Reactions

Other potential side effects have been reported, although they are less common:

  • Insomnia: Excessive biotin intake can lead to a surge of energy, making it difficult to sleep. Taking the supplement in the morning may help mitigate this effect.
  • Kidney strain: High, long-term doses of biotin could put a strain on the kidneys, especially for individuals with pre-existing kidney conditions.
  • Excessive thirst and urination: These symptoms are also associated with high levels of biotin.

The Role of Medical Supervision

Because biotin supplements are widely available over-the-counter and are not closely regulated for purity or potency by the FDA, their use should be approached with caution. The claims for improving hair, skin, and nail health are largely unsubstantiated by scientific evidence in healthy individuals. Only those with a diagnosed biotin deficiency, a rare genetic disorder, or certain medical conditions should consider supplementation, and only under a doctor's supervision. For most people, a balanced diet rich in biotin from natural sources—like egg yolks, nuts, and leafy greens—is sufficient and risk-free.
